【问题标题】:electron cannot find module package.json电子找不到模块 package.json
【发布时间】:2017-01-09 05:01:33
【问题描述】:

这是我第一次使用电子并且我试图运行一个快速应用程序,它给了我这个错误

更新代码

Error: Cannot find module 'C:\package.json'
    at Module._resolveFilename (module.js:440:15)
    at Function.Module._resolveFilename (C:\Users\marku_000\AppData\Roaming\npm\node_modules\electron\dist\resources\electron.asar\common\reset-search-paths.js:35:12)

感谢任何帮助

【问题讨论】:

  • 您是否尝试从应用程序的文件夹中运行它?
  • 是的,当然,我不知道为什么会发生这个错误,但我已经通过在 c/ 处创建一个空的 package.json 来修复它
  • 这是一个奇怪的错误

标签: javascript node.js express npm electron


【解决方案1】:

您是否已将项目从一个目录移动到另一个目录?这样做时我遇到了同样的错误,并通过以下步骤修复了它:

1) 删除 node_modules 目录; rm -rf node_modules

2) 安装依赖; npm install

3) 重新构建它; npm run build:prod

【讨论】:

    猜你喜欢
    • 2020-11-27
    • 1970-01-01
    • 2016-02-28
    • 2021-12-21
    • 2020-10-09
    • 1970-01-01
    • 2023-01-23
    • 1970-01-01
    • 2016-03-29
    相关资源
    最近更新 更多